Abstract

The application discloses a medical insurance bill auditing method, a block chain link point device and a system, wherein the method comprises the following steps: the target blockchain node equipment receives a medical insurance bill auditing request sent by a medical insurance bill auditing request terminal, wherein the medical insurance bill request carries a first unique identifier of a medical insurance bill; the target blockchain node equipment determines a target medical insurance ticket containing a first unique identifier of the medical insurance ticket from a plurality of medical insurance tickets according to target information which is stored in a blockchain network in advance and contains the medical insurance ticket; the target block chain link point equipment compares the content in the medical insurance bill with the content in the target medical insurance bill; if the medical insurance bill is different, the target blockchain node equipment sends an audit report to the medical insurance bill audit request terminal, wherein the audit report is used for indicating the difference between the medical insurance bill and the content in the target medical insurance bill and the fact that the medical insurance bill is false. By adopting the application, the auditing efficiency can be improved.

Background
For a sound medical system, the integrity of the medical insurance fund is ensured, and a medical management department makes clear responsibility regulations for related personnel such as medical institutions, paramedics, staff and the like, which violate basic medical insurance regulations, so as to prevent the liability personnel from cheating the medical insurance fund.
In the prior art, the auditing of the medical insurance reimbursement receipts is manually audited, audit personnel need to check the receipts in a tedious way, the auditing efficiency is low, the auditing quality is not high, a large number of illegal reimbursement receipts are easy to appear, and finally the medical insurance foundation is lost.
Disclosure of Invention
The application provides a medical insurance bill auditing method, block chain link point equipment and a system, which can realize the reliable storage of information such as medical insurance bill and the like on one hand and provide true and reliable medical insurance bill information for medical insurance bill auditing parties; on the other hand, the auditing efficiency of the medical insurance bill can be improved, and the risk of medical insurance fund loss is reduced.

The blockchain has the following three properties: 1. blockchain is a distributed database system placed in an unsecure environment; 2. adopting a hash function mode to ensure that the existing data is not tampered; 3. and adopting a consensus algorithm to agree on the newly added data.
Embodiments of the present application are generally directed to the property of tamper resistance by employing a hash function to ensure that target information stored on a blockchain is not tampered with.
It should be noted that the hash function has the following properties, and assuming that X is obtained by hashing, y=h (X), then: knowing X, Y is easy to derive, whereas knowing Y does not, in particular, there is no other X1, so that H (X1) =y. That is, the hash function has irreversibility.
Referring to fig. 3, fig. 3 is a schematic flow chart of a medical insurance ticket auditing method according to an embodiment of the present application.
As shown in fig. 3, the following details the medical insurance ticket auditing method provided by the medical insurance ticket auditing system, the method may at least include the following steps:
s301, the target blockchain node equipment receives a medical insurance bill auditing request sent by a medical insurance bill auditing request terminal.
In an embodiment of the present application, the medical insurance ticket may include: the number of the medical insurance bill, the registration number of the patient in the medical institution in the medical insurance bill, the diagnosis items in the medical insurance bill and the corresponding fees of the diagnosis items, the identification card number, the name, the sex, the contact way, the name of the medical institution and the like of the patient in the medical insurance bill.
The medical insurance ticket request carries a first unique identifier of the medical insurance ticket; the first unique identification includes: the bill number of the medical insurance bill, the registration number of the patient in the medical institution in the medical insurance bill.
The contents of the medical insurance ticket include: the diagnosis items in the medical insurance bill and the corresponding fees of the diagnosis items, the identification card number, the name, the sex, the contact information and other information of the patient in the medical insurance bill.
The medical insurance bill auditing request terminal is deployed on a medical insurance bill auditing request party; wherein, medical insurance bill auditing requesting party includes: the human resource society security bureau.
It should be noted that the target block link point device is one block link point device in a block chain network.
Fig. 4 illustrates a schematic diagram of a medical insurance ticket.
As shown in fig. 4, the charging ticket may include: the bill number of the charging bill (KL 36745674), the registration number of the patient in the charging bill at XX hospital (0004883472), the name of the medical institution where the patient is in the charging bill, the name, sex, date of the treatment (2018, 6, 9 days), and diagnostic item (physical examination).
S302, the target block chain link point device determines a target medical insurance ticket containing a first unique identifier from a plurality of medical insurance tickets according to a plurality of target information containing the medical insurance tickets which are pre-stored in the block chain network.
Specifically, the target blockchain node device scans each medical insurance ticket in the plurality of medical insurance tickets into a medical insurance ticket image through an optical character recognition technology (Optical Character Recognition, OCR) according to a plurality of target information containing the medical insurance tickets stored in the blockchain network in advance, further extracts text features of each medical insurance ticket image in the plurality of medical insurance ticket images, compares the extracted text features with text features in a text feature database, and recognizes the text of each medical insurance ticket image in the plurality of medical insurance ticket images, so that the target medical insurance ticket containing the first unique identifier is determined from the plurality of medical insurance tickets.
For example, the block link point device may scan the charging bill shown in fig. 4 into a charging bill image by OCR technology, further perform text feature extraction on text in the charging bill image, and then compare the extracted text feature with text feature in the text feature database to identify text in the charging bill image, so as to determine the bill number (KL 36745674) of the charging bill in the charging bill, the registration number (0004883472) of the patient in the XX hospital in the charging bill, the name of the patient, the name, the sex, the date of the patient (6/9/2018) of the patient in the charging bill, and the diagnostic item (body inspection).
It should be noted that, before determining the target medical insurance ticket containing the first unique identifier from the plurality of medical insurance tickets according to the target information containing the medical insurance tickets pre-stored in the blockchain network, the target blockchain link point device further includes the following working procedures:
process one: the target block link point device receives a plurality of medical insurance tickets sent by medical insurance ticket providing terminals deployed in a plurality of medical institutions respectively.
In particular, the medical insurance ticket providing terminal may store the medical insurance ticket in two ways, including but not limited to.
The first way is: and storing the medical insurance ticket in a cloud database connected with a medical insurance ticket providing terminal.
The second way is: the medical insurance ticket is stored in an internal memory of the medical insurance ticket providing terminal.
And a second process: the target block link point device generates a second unique identification for each of the plurality of medical insurance policies based on the characteristic value of each of the medical insurance policies.
Wherein, the characteristic value at least comprises:
the bill number of the medical insurance bill, the registration number of the patient in the medical institution in the medical insurance bill.
The target block chain link point equipment receives the medical insurance notes respectively, which are sent by the medical insurance note providing terminal of the medical insurance institutions, carries out hash operation on the characteristic value of each medical insurance note in the medical insurance notes respectively, and takes the hash value after the hash operation as a second unique identifier of each medical insurance note respectively.
It should be noted that, the characteristic values in the medical insurance ticket at least include: the bill number of the medical insurance bill, the registration number of the patient in the medical institution in the medical insurance bill, and the name, the identification card number, the contact mode, and the like of the patient can be included.
And a third process: the target blockchain node device sends a plurality of target information to other blockchain node devices outside the blockchain node device, so that the other blockchain node devices verify the plurality of target information, wherein the target information comprises: the medical insurance ticket and the second unique identifier of the medical insurance ticket.
Specifically, the target blockchain node device sends a plurality of target information to other blockchain link point devices except the target blockchain link point device in the blockchain network, so that the first blockchain node device carries out hash operation on the characteristic value of the medical insurance ticket in the first target information according to a hash function used when the target blockchain link point device generates the second unique identifier of the medical insurance ticket in the first target information, and the hash value after the hash operation is compared with the received second unique identifier of the medical insurance ticket in the first target information sent by the target blockchain link point device; the first target block link point device is any block link point device except the target block link point device in the block chain network, and the first target information is any target information in a plurality of target information;
If the hash value after the hash operation is the same as the received second unique identification of the first target information sent by the target block link point device, the first target information passes verification.
And a process IV: if the plurality of target information passes the verification, the target block link point device generates a target block containing the plurality of target information.
Specifically, the blocks on the blockchain network are composed of block heads and block bodies. The block header includes the hash value of the current block, the hash value of the previous block, the timestamp and other information, and the block body includes the data information of the current block.
Taking the medical insurance bill uploaded by the staff of the medical institution as an example, as shown in fig. 5, the block structures of the block N and the block (n+1) are the same, and the medical insurance bill is stored in the block main body.
And a fifth process: the target block link point device writes the target block to the blockchain network.
Specifically, the specific manner in which a target block containing multiple target information is written to the blockchain network is described in detail below.
Firstly, taking the last block on the existing block chain network as the last block of the target block, and recording the hash value of the last block in the block head of the target block; and then recording the current time as the time stamp of the target block, and when the next new block is generated, taking the target block as the previous block of the new block, wherein the hash value of the target block is recorded in the block head of the new block. Wherein, the last block on the blockchain network refers to the block with the time of the timestamp record closest to the current time in all blocks on the blockchain network.
In summary, the objective block records the hash value of the last block and the hash value of the target block, and the objective is to ensure the non-tamper-resistance of the medical insurance ticket by utilizing the chain structure and the irreversibility of the hash encryption algorithm connected in front and back on the blockchain network.
For example, as shown in fig. 6, consider a block 1-4 on a blockchain network, where the block 1 holds the hash value H0 of the previous block, the hash value H1 of the block 1, and the data block a of the block 1, and the block 2 holds the hash value H1 of the previous block, the hash value H2 of the block 2, and the data block B of the block 2, the block 3-level block 4, and so on. For each block, the hash value of the block is calculated by performing hash operation on the data synthesized by the data block of the block and the hash value of the last block.
For example, the hash value of block 1 to block 4 in fig. 6 is calculated by: h1 =hash (a|h0), h2=hash (b|h1), h3=hash (c|h2), h4=hash (d|h3), where|denotes concatenation and Hash denotes a Hash operation. In summary, it can be seen that, if a data block on any block is tampered with, the hash values on all blocks after the block on the blockchain network need to be changed according to the connection relationship between the front block and the back block. For example: if the contents of data block a on block 1 in fig. 6 were to be changed, the hash values in Ha Xitou on block 2, block 3, block 4 and subsequent blocks would need to be changed accordingly. Obviously, the difficulty is high, the cost is very high, and in theory, 51% and more nodes (the nodes can create new blocks, commonly called mining nodes) on the blockchain network are controlled, so that the tampering of the data can be completed.
S303, the target block chain link point equipment compares the content in the medical insurance bill with the content in the target medical insurance bill.
Specifically, the target block link point device compares the medical insurance ticket with the target medical insurance ticket according to various information such as a diagnosis item in the medical insurance ticket and a fee corresponding to the diagnosis item in the content of the medical insurance ticket.
Taking pregnant women's labor exam as an example, diagnostic items may include, but are not limited to: urine analysis, blood glucose analysis, four-dimensional color ultrasound, glucose tolerance test and the like.
And S304, if the content in the medical insurance bill is different from the content in the target medical insurance bill, the target blockchain node equipment sends an audit report to the medical insurance bill audit request terminal, wherein the audit report is used for indicating the difference between the medical insurance bill and the content in the target medical insurance bill and the fact that the medical insurance bill is false to the medical insurance bill audit request party.
Specifically, with reference to fig. 4, if the blockchain node device determines that the diagnostic fee (8.60) in the medical charging receipt sent by the medical insurance policy providing terminal is different from the diagnostic fee (6.00) in the target medical charging receipt stored in the blockchain, the audit report generated by the target blockchain node device may include the following contents: A. suspicious items: diagnostic fee 8.60 (reference result: diagnostic fee 6.00), B, audit prompt: the medical insurance ticket is false, suggesting that further auditing of the medical charging ticket be performed manually.
It should be noted that after the target blockchain link point device compares the content in the medical insurance ticket with the content in the target medical insurance ticket, if the content in the medical insurance ticket is all the same as the content in the target medical insurance ticket, the blockchain node device sends a first prompting medical insurance ticket request terminal; the first prompt is used for prompting the medical insurance bill auditing requester that the medical insurance bill is true.
